Offchain Labs confirmed a significant fee allocation for the Arbitrum ecosystem, promising long-term value. But in a cautious market, is smart money waiting for a dip to accumulate?

Offchain Labs Co-Founder Steven Goldfeder stated that 10% of fees collected on Robinhood Chain and other Arbitrum Layer 2s will now flow directly into the Arbitrum ecosystem.

This announcement is a structural positive for the Arbitrum network. It strengthens long-term value accrual for the ecosystem and its native token.

However, this news arrives amidst a broader crypto market correction. Bitcoin was trading near $61,820 as of 03:24 UTC, down 1.8% over 24 hours.

Ethereum also saw a 2.0% decrease over 24 hours to $1726.29, while Solana dropped 2.9% to $76.89 in the same period.

Why Arbitrum's new fee structure matters

The allocation of 10% of fees from growing L2s, like Robinhood Chain, directly to the Arbitrum ecosystem is a significant development. It creates a robust, self-sustaining funding mechanism.

This fee contribution can fuel further development, incentivize builders, and potentially enhance the utility and demand for the ARB token. It signals increasing economic activity flowing back to the core network.

For long-term holders, this represents a clear pathway for value accrual. It strengthens the network's fundamentals and its competitive position in the L2 space.

What to watch for: confirmation of accumulation

Traders should watch for specific indicators to confirm the anticipated market flush. Bitcoin pushing towards the $59,000-$60,000 support zone is a key signal.

A significant decrease in Bitcoin open interest, ideally towards $18 billion, would suggest de-risking and position closures. This often precedes a short-term bottom.

Funding rates across exchanges turning negative or 'cold' (blue to greenish) would indicate a shift towards bearish positioning. This provides fuel for a subsequent short squeeze.

Confirmation of the 'exhale' structure for the secondary wave, as indicated by bearish candlestick patterns, would further validate the downside target.

Invalidation of this bearish short-term thesis would involve Bitcoin holding strong above $60,000-$61,000 and showing sustained buying pressure. A rapid recovery without hitting lower targets would suggest a premature accumulation.
